Drink driving offenses occur when an individual operates a vehicle while under the influence of alcohol or drugs, exceeding the legal limit. These offenses can vary in severity, from driving with a low level of alcohol in your system to high-level offenses that carry severe penalties. Understanding the specific charges against you is crucial to building a strong defense.

Penalties for drink driving can include a driving ban, a fine, imprisonment, and a criminal record. The severity of the penalty depends on factors such as the level of alcohol, whether there was an accident, and if there are prior convictions.
Refusing a breathalyzer test is an offense and can result in similar penalties to those for drink driving, including a driving ban, a fine, and possible imprisonment.
A solicitor can provide legal advice, represent you in court, challenge the evidence against you, and potentially negotiate for a reduced penalty. They can also advise on the potential impacts on your license and employment.
In some cases, mitigating factors, such as a clean driving record or completing a drink driving rehabilitation course, can lead to a reduced sentence. A solicitor can help present these factors to the court.
Repeat drink driving offenses result in harsher penalties, including longer driving bans, larger fines, and longer prison sentences. It’s crucial to seek legal advice if you face repeat charges.
